Sega’s Mega Drive Console is kept in high regard by gamers all ages and there are many voices who ask for a new gaming console from the company. Although it appears this will never happen, at least Sega is seriously considering to let us taste a bit of that glorious past in a next-gen format.

In other words, the company announced the release of Sega Mega Drive Ultimate Collection for Xbox 360 and PlayStation 3, a compilation of the best first-party games from the 16-bit era. As if that was not enough, bonus content from the Master System is announced (but we don’t know what to expect yet).

“Sega Mega Drive Ultimate Collection is a must-have for any Sega enthusiast,” commented Gary Knight, European Marketing Director for Sega Europe. “Fans will get a chance to relive fond memories from these classic games in HD format.”

We’re talking about 40 games in this collection, including Sonic the Hedgehog 1, 2 and 3, Columns, Alien Storm, Ecco the Dolphin, Space Harrier and Streets of Rage 1, 2 and 3. The games have been reproduced to bring a new visual joy, including support for HD TVs. Doesn’t that sound great?
